From the Guidelines
For atypical pneumonia in pediatric patients, macrolide antibiotics are the first-line treatment, with azithromycin being the preferred choice at 10 mg/kg on day 1 (maximum 500 mg) followed by 5 mg/kg daily for 4 more days, as recommended by the most recent guidelines 1. The treatment of atypical pneumonia in pediatric patients should prioritize the use of macrolide antibiotics due to their effectiveness against common pathogens such as Mycoplasma pneumoniae and Chlamydophila pneumoniae.
- Key considerations include:
- Age: For children aged 5 and above, macrolide antibiotics may be used as first-line empirical treatment 1.
- Suspected pathogen: If Mycoplasma or Chlamydia pneumonia is suspected, macrolide antibiotics should be used 1.
- Allergies: For children with beta-lactam allergies or in areas with high macrolide resistance, doxycycline can be used in children over 8 years old at 2-4 mg/kg/day divided twice daily for 7-14 days 1.
- Treatment should be accompanied by supportive care including:
- Adequate hydration
- Rest
- Fever management
- Most children can be treated as outpatients, but those with respiratory distress, hypoxemia, inability to maintain oral intake, or significant comorbidities may require hospitalization for intravenous antibiotics and supportive care 1. The guidelines from the Pediatric Infectious Diseases Society and the Infectious Diseases Society of America 1 provide the most recent and comprehensive recommendations for the treatment of atypical pneumonia in pediatric patients.
From the FDA Drug Label
Community-Acquired Pneumonia The recommended dose of azithromycin for oral suspension for the treatment of pediatric patients with community-acquired pneumonia is 10 mg/kg as a single dose on the first day followed by 5 mg/kg on Days 2 through 5.
The treatment for community-acquired pneumonia in the pediatric population is azithromycin for oral suspension with a recommended dose of 10 mg/kg as a single dose on the first day followed by 5 mg/kg on Days 2 through 5 2.
- Key points:
- The dose is based on the patient's weight.
- The treatment duration is 5 days.
- The effectiveness of the 3-day or 1-day regimen in pediatric patients with community-acquired pneumonia has not been established.
From the Research
Treatment Options for Atypical Pneumonia in Children
The treatment for atypical pneumonia in the pediatric population typically involves the use of antibiotics that are effective against the causative pathogens, which include Mycoplasma pneumoniae, Chlamydophila pneumoniae, and Legionella pneumophila 3, 4.
- Macrolides, such as azithromycin and erythromycin, are commonly used to treat atypical pneumonia in children due to their efficacy and safety profile 3, 5, 6.
- Azithromycin has been shown to be an effective therapeutic option for the treatment of community-acquired classic and atypical pneumonia in children, with a shorter treatment course and fewer side effects compared to erythromycin 5.
- Tetracyclines, such as doxycycline, may also be used to treat atypical pneumonia, but their use is generally limited to older children due to the risk of tooth discoloration and other side effects 3.
- Fluoroquinolones may be used as an alternative treatment option, but their use is generally reserved for severe cases or when other antibiotics are not effective 3, 4.
Antibiotic Resistance and Treatment Considerations
The increasing incidence of macrolide-resistant M. pneumoniae is a concern, and the use of empirical macrolide therapy in children with mild to moderate community-acquired pneumonia may not provide additional benefits over β-lactam monotherapy and can increase the risk of resistance 4.
- The choice of antibiotic should be based on the suspected or confirmed causative pathogen, as well as the patient's age, weight, and medical history 3, 5, 4.
- Azithromycin therapy has been shown to improve acute episodes and reduce recurrences in children with recurrent respiratory tract infections, particularly those with atypical bacterial infections 7.
